Historical sites in Bangkok

Explore the rich history and culture of Bangkok by visiting its historical sites. In 2023, you can discover over 20 top-notch heritage sites, ancient ruins, and archaeological wonders in this vibrant city.

Start your journey at the iconic Grand Palace, a symbol of Thailand’s historical significance. Marvel at its intricate architecture and learn about the royal legacy it holds. Immerse yourself in the bustling streets of Chinatown, where you’ll find historical attractions that showcase the city’s multicultural past.

Don’t miss the Erawan Shrine, a sacred site that attracts visitors with its stunning craftsmanship. Another must-visit is Wat Pho, home to an impressive reclining Buddha statue and exquisite pagodas.

Immersion in hill tribe cultures of the north

Immerse yourself in the unique and fascinating cultures of the hill tribes in northern Thailand. As part of the Highlights of Thailand student trips, this experience allows you to learn about ethnic minority groups and indigenous communities firsthand.

You’ll have authentic experiences that promote crosscultural understanding and experiential learning. Through cultural exchange with local communities, you’ll get to witness traditional practices and learn about their customs.

This immersion program offers a valuable opportunity for intercultural communication, fostering a deeper appreciation for diversity.

The trip includes visits to Chiang Mai, renowned for its ancient temples, street markets, and Buddhist heritage. Here, you’ll have the chance to interact with members of various hill tribe communities such as Karen, Akha, Lahu, Hmong, Yao, Lisu and many more.

You can participate in traditional activities like weaving textiles or crafting intricate silver jewelry alongside skilled artisans from these tribes. By living among them for a short period of time through home-stays or village visits guided by experienced local guides from EF Education First , you’ll gain insights into their way of life while forming lasting connections.

Chiang Mai

Chiang Mai is a special place in Thailand that’s popular for its rich cultural heritage and historical landmarks. It’s a great destination for educational trips, where students can learn about Thai traditions and immerse themselves in the local culture.

The city is home to stunning Buddhist temples, such as Wat Phra Singh and Wat Chedi Luang. Apart from exploring these architectural wonders, students can also visit elephant sanctuaries, shop at local markets, and go on countryside explorations.

Chiang Mai has a tropical climate with distinct wet and dry seasons, offering students the opportunity to experience the beautiful weather while learning about Thai traditions.

In Chiang Mai, there are plenty of activities for students to enjoy and learn from. They can witness traditional ceremonies at temples or take part in various cultural workshops like cooking classes or traditional arts and crafts.

Students can also have meaningful interactions with locals through community service projects aimed at making positive contributions to the region. With its unique blend of history, natural beauty, and cultural experiences, Chiang Mai provides an enriching environment for student trips to Thailand.

Chiang Rai

Chiang Rai, located in northern Thailand, is a city and province that offers a rich cultural experience. It is known for its ancient royal temples, impressive artwork, and interesting museums.

When you visit Chiang Rai, you can immerse yourself in the unique Lanna culture of the region. You’ll have the chance to explore beautiful temples, wander through vibrant night markets, and even visit quirky cat cafes.

The city is also surrounded by breathtaking mountains and tea fields, providing opportunities for scenic treks and peaceful moments of relaxation. As you soak up the atmosphere, you’ll get a taste of the cultural diversity and spirituality that make Chiang Rai so special.

Pai

Pai is a picturesque town located in the Northern Thai countryside, and it’s a popular destination for tourists. This charming town offers a peaceful ambiance and abundant natural beauty.

Surrounded by lush mountains and verdant rice fields, Pai provides scenic views that will take your breath away. The town is also known for its cultural diversity, with local Thai traditions blending seamlessly with the customs of hill tribe villages in the area.

One of the highlights of visiting Pai is spending time by the picturesque riverfront, where you can relax and soak in the tranquility of this serene location. And if you’re planning to visit Chiang Mai, good news – Pai is conveniently located just a three-hour drive away from there!

Koh Chang

Koh Chang is a beautiful island located in Trat province, not too far from Bangkok and near the Cambodian border. It’s known for its untouched rainforest that covers 70% of the island.

If you’re looking for outdoor activities and attractions, Koh Chang has it all. You can enjoy the stunning beaches, watch breathtaking sunsets, explore nature trails, go hiking, try kayaking or snorkeling, and even visit nearby islands.

With its dense jungles, scenic hiking trails, natural wonders,and charming coastal villages,Koh Chang is definitely worth visiting. Whether you’re traveling alone or as a couple, this friendly island offers a great vibe for everyone.
